Python blender script downloader

Meant for installation into a virtualenv or wherever, for unit testing of blender extensions being authored, or developement of a blender 3denabled python application. Blender and python console in this course we use python, which conveniently comes with blender. Blender scripting with python will teach you how to develop custom scripts and helpful addons to. A supported python installation with pip installed. Blender has an internal text editor to write scripts on python language.

Open up blender and browse to the generated python file from a text window. Using blender s python that should be in the bin folder run the module ensure pip, like in the image below. So making collisions and links are the two most important things the addon can do. So here is how you can run a python script in blender.

How to install the script download the file,unzip, and drop it in the folder. An understanding of the basics of python is expected for those working through this tutorial. These are changes that you can do right now, other api changes are. If you use blender as a modeling and animation tool1 you can use python to model a scene by programming how the scene should build itself or you can write import and export scripts to. Download the package from the official python website. Featuring an extensive python api, every tool is available for scripting and customization. Then run blender and it will recognize the script automatically. Blender is a public project, made by hundreds of people from around the world. It should not be hard to alter this script so it autodetects the os and downloads the appropriate version. Python 3 is the language future but not backwardcompatible conversion is mostly painless. Python accesses blenders data in the same way as the animation system and user interface. In this video, we will be creating a new addon i call, the text tool addon. It describes creating simple scene, adding lights and cameras and creating simple animation. Engineering and manufacturing animation software design and construction cad software cadcam systems computer programs computer animation computer programming open source software programming languages usage public software python programming language.

I wanted to create an addon that would help speed up our workflow when adding text within blender. The blendbridge library is distributed as a perk in the twingsisters internal crowdfunding campaign. This course is an introduction to python scripting for blender artists that focuses on how you can utilize the power of python in blender. Blender python interfaces scripts gui scripts for short essentially work by providing blender with a set of callbacks to allow passage of events and drawing, and then the script. So after downloading your addon files it will be either a. In this tutorial well learn how to write a simple python export script for blender. From simple ideas like using blenders python console as a calculator to scripting a reusable tool operator that makes repetitive tasks easier for yourself. Aug 30, 2016 python is a powerful, highlevel, dynamic language. Once the python file is loaded into a blender text window, press altp to execute the. Whether youre an artist or a developer, scripting is a great selling point to add to your resume. It exhibits an internal full fledged python interpreter.

It basically checks a database every 25 seconds and render the text from in blender and then saves it. Using ps4 controller in the blender game engine download. Jul 14, 2009 brendon murphy aka metaandrocto has created script toolkits where you can downloada scripts by category. I have been able to use python scripts to get information like the coordiates of the vertices about the objects in blender. Blender is the free and open source 3d creation suite.

Nathans blender python notebook the proving ground. Therefore a blender addon can be as simple as a single python file with the. I would like to learn from my mistakes, ive just started coding with python. Watched the demo on youtube and this is a perfect test for a surf game, on wave simulation. The python console can be used to test small bits of python code which can then be pasted into larger scripts. It expects to be run on a win64 system with python3. If you are unfamiliar with python, start with the python book. Python build script for blender as a python module. Sep 15, 2016 make blender better by harnessing the power of python. If you enjoy blendernation and you think its a valuable resource to the blender community.

Wing pro is the fullfeatured python ide for professional developers, and wing personal is a free alternative with reduced feature set. Unpack content of zip file to your blender script folder under windows typically something like. Make blender better by harnessing the power of python. This is a python script that allows you to use blender as a dropper. How to install python modules in blender using pip. For most unix systems, you must download and compile the source code. Extend the possibilities for animation in blender with python scripting. The code and examples on nathans blender python notebook pages are free software. I have a script that runs in a while loops infinitely.

However, this editor is much inferior to specially designed for writing code. Historically, most, but not all, python releases have also been gplcompatible. In this tutorial i will teach you how to create physics simulations using blender 2. Full blender integrated documentation and multilanguage translation help python script for blender, a free open source 3d content creation suite, available for all major operating systems under the gnu general public license. If the sample code of an easy function is shown, the rest will be made by myself. The best blender 3d stories in the python scripts category. However, i would also like to be able to use python scripts to move andor extrude vertices. Python scripting the text tool addon blendernation. This allows any user to add functionalities by writing a python script. Before going through the tutorial you should be familiar with the basics of working in blender.

Ive seen various suggestions to split a single frame render across a farm. In this video i show how to update your addon python scripts for blender 2. However pip is not part of the official python distribution so it needs to be added separately. Let us now step through the process of configuring blender so that artists and developers can have a. More commonly though is that an addon is a collection of files contained in a. Programming games in blender is possibel in two ways but starting the game engine, in short bge or bge, works allways the same. Python accesses blender s data in the same way as the animation system and user interface. This introduction explains basics of blender and the use of its python console. Does anyone know of any decent 3d physics engines for python 3 that work on windows.

Python script that can downloads public and private profiles images and videos, like gallery with photos or videos. If you come across any errors please leave a comment below. It is not recommended to use these on production environments. A demo on running blender with a python script for generating and rendering a scene. So, remembering the blender python exporters, i volunteered to write an export script for blender, so it could be used as level editor. Mesh x mirror for modders blender script at skyrim nexus. Free ebook for programming blender in python geeks3d.

This tutorial is up to date with the latest version of blender. This is a python document pdf downloader i made to download some question papers automatically. This tutorial is designed to help technical artists or developers learn to extend blender. The python scripts are licensed under the gnu general public license v2 or higher. Blender as a python module is only available if you build blender from source. We will need a panel for our button and a popup dialog box to execute the operation and weread more. Blender addons are made with the programming language python. The blender markets goal is to give our community a trusted platform for earning a living with software that we all love, blender. I have just been googling around for a few weeks and have come up with this list of 3d physics engines, along with why i cant use them. Moving vertices with python scripts and finding info about. A quick and dirty python script that downloads stuff from. And it worked out very well, blender can be completely used as level editor for that game now. This script by rich colburn is going to change the way you think about cloth this python script by michael davies will create spaceships with a lot of greeble for mahlon writes.

A blender addon to draw seashell surfaces in python using the blendbridge library. The same source code archive can also be used to build. When debugging a script, if we wish to read the diagnostic info supplied by print, well need to open blender from command line. Blender has a very powerful yet often overlooked feature. Using external ide pycharm for writing blender scripts. Checking the availability of instagram profile if its private or existing. To install it, you go to fileuser preferencesaddons tabinstall from file found at the bottomchoose your downloaded addonthen the addon information will appear after installing itclick the checkbox and the addon will be active. Contribute to vdriftblenderscripts development by creating an account on github. Python scripting for the blender game engine cg masters.

The python console is a good way to explore the possibilities of blender builtin python. This is simple blender python script for setting 3d background empty object. Experimental builds have the latest features and while there might be cool bug fixes too, they are unstable and can mess up your files. Does anyone know of any decent 3d physics engines for python. Is there a way to write a python script to do this.

This script can bake uv texture into vertex color layer. Once you master the basics, you can automate timeconsuming modeling and animation tasks, customize the blender interface, or even package to share or sell your enhancements to other users. We are working on fixing missing content and on a better way to organize and present the information. Inspired from the 2d simulator really 1998 and lagoa multiphysic in softimage. In this beginners bge python tutorial youll learn how to use python scripting in blender to make a car move, increase in speed, and stop. Blender python scripts 4musemans delightful unrealities. Export your model from allplan in 3ds format, and use this script to import your model in your blender scene dxfimporter. I want to know how to make a mesh having vertices and faces by using python script from mathematical equations, for example, spherical harmonics, and so on. Script runner will also store the paths to your frequently used scripts so you wont have to reenter them with either new blender files, or with new versions of blender. This is a python script that fetches the latest win64 build for blender.

Downloadinstall blender objectives for the competition you need the software blender. Log in in instragram using selenium and navigate to the profile. This code will download only non ed youtube videos due to the new algorithms for accessing video files taht youtube had changed. There are several arguments you need to pass, to make scripts like this work. Blender comes with python, and includes a standalone python executable. On saturday, february 25th i hosted a workshop in boston.

In a perfect world, after you have downloaded an addon, all you would have to do is. It supports the entirety of the 3d pipelinemodeling, rigging, animation, simulation, rendering, compositing and motion tracking, video editing and 2d animation pipeline. Select blender as the output type and click export. Well, blender s api changed shortly after i wrote that and the original script no longer works in the latest versions of blender. Years ago i realized i could use blender for this purpose and wrote a simple python script to export data about the scene. Contribute to gethioxgxaudiovisualisation development by creating an account on github. Because we can include the rigid body physics in the script this method is more flexible and. Learn how to script common animation tasks, customize the interface, and even build addons to sell to other users. Python is an interpreted, interactive, objectoriented programming language. How do you setup pip with blender s bundled python so it can be used to install python packages from pypi which are then available from inside blender. This is simple blender python script for setting 3d.

The licenses page details gplcompatibility and terms and conditions. Blender artists is an online creative forum that is dedicated to the growth and education of the 3d software blender. You can even load an entire directory of frequently used python scripts into the script runner panel all at once. Blender scripting with python will teach you how to develop custom scripts and helpful addons to streamline and automate your workflow, as well as tricks on. Get rid of render noise while preserving visual detail as well as possible. This addon can be used either in blender or in blender with sverchok or animation nodes. How do i get it to stop when i want it to without crashing blender. Some pitfalls are discussed, therefore the fun factor is still at a hight level.

1530 1563 866 508 1178 1113 1067 1014 294 757 18 42 1494 327 175 1092 410 659 1194 163 1098 359 1314 897 1326 295 631 1073 1257 858 437 1331